Inflation drops to a 3-year low with CPI rising simply 2.5% in August
SHARE



The post-pandemic spike in U.S. inflation eased additional final month as year-over-year value will increase reached a three-year low, clearing the best way for the Federal Reserve to chop rates of interest subsequent week.

Wednesday’s report from the Labor Division confirmed that client costs rose 2.5% in August from a 12 months earlier. It was the fifth straight annual drop and the smallest such enhance since February 2021. From July to August, costs rose simply 0.2%.

Excluding risky meals and vitality prices, so-called core costs rose 3.2% in August from 12 months earlier, the identical as in July. On a month-to-month foundation, core costs rose 0.3% final month, a pickup from July’s 0.2% enhance. Economists carefully watch core costs, which usually present a greater learn of future inflation traits.

For months, falling inflation has supplied gradual reduction to America’s shoppers, who had been stung by the value surges that erupted three years in the past, notably for meals, gasoline, lease and different requirements. Inflation peaked in mid-2022 at 9.1%, the best charge in 4 a long time.

Fed officers have signaled that they’re more and more assured that inflation is falling again to their 2% goal and at the moment are shifting their focus to supporting the job market, which is steadily cooling. Consequently, the policymakers are poised to start reducing their key charge from its 23-year excessive in hopes of bolstering progress and hiring.

A modest quarter-point minimize is extensively anticipated subsequent week. Over time, a collection of charge cuts ought to scale back the price of borrowing throughout the economic system, together with for mortgages, auto loans and bank cards.

The newest inflation figures might inject themselves into the presidential race in its last weeks. Former President Donald Trump has heaped blame on Vice President Kamala Harris for the soar in inflation, which erupted in early 2021 as international provide chains seized up, inflicting extreme shortages of components and labor. Harris has proposed subsidies for residence patrons and builders in an effort to ease housing prices and backs a federal ban on price-gouging for groceries. Trump has stated he would increase vitality manufacturing to attempt to scale back total inflation.

A key purpose why inflation eased once more in August was that gasoline costs tumbled by about 10 cents a gallon final month, in keeping with the Vitality Inflation Administration, to a nationwide common of about $3.29.

Economists additionally anticipate the federal government’s measures of grocery costs and rents to rise extra slowly. Although meals costs are roughly 20% costlier than earlier than the pandemic, they’ve barely budged over the previous 12 months.

One other potential driver of slower inflation is that the price of new house leases has began to chill as a stream of newly constructed flats have been accomplished.

In keeping with the true property brokerage Redfin, the median lease for a brand new lease rose simply 0.9% in August from a 12 months earlier, to $1,645 a month. However the authorities’s measure consists of all rents, together with these for individuals who have been of their flats for months or years. It takes time for the slowdown in new rents to indicate up within the authorities’s information. In July, rental prices rose 5.1% from a 12 months in the past, in keeping with the federal government’s client value index.

Individuals’ paychecks are additionally rising extra slowly — a median of about 3.5% yearly, nonetheless a strong tempo — which reduces inflationary pressures. Two years in the past, wage progress was topping 5%, a stage that may drive companies to sharply elevate costs to cowl their greater labor prices.

In a high-profile speech final month, Fed Chair Jerome Powell famous that inflation was coming below management and instructed that the job market was unlikely to be a supply of inflationary stress.

Shoppers have propelled the economic system for the previous three years. However they’re more and more turning to debt to take care of their spending and bank card, and auto delinquencies are rising, elevating issues that they might need to rein of their spending quickly. Decreased client spending could lead on extra employers to freeze their hiring and even minimize jobs.
